пользовательская форма с webview-элементом не загружается, программа зависает - PullRequest
0 голосов
/ 23 января 2019

Я новичок в использовании Visual Studio, а также Visual Basic и до сих пор борюсь с тем, чтобы что-нибудь запустить. Единственный опыт, который у меня есть, - это работа с VBA в Excel.

Моя цель состояла в том, чтобы создать пользовательскую форму, которая связывает меня с часто используемыми веб-страницами, без использования моего обычно используемого браузера. Поскольку мне нужна форма для отображения веб-плеера, который не поддерживает Internet Explorer ни в одной версии, форма webbrowser-windows не соответствует моим потребностям. Однако я обнаружил, что существует форма окон веб-просмотра, которая использует механизм рендеринга краев и должна правильно загружать веб-плеер.

У меня есть стартовая страница как пользовательская форма с двумя кнопками. Номер один открывает второе окно с веб-браузером. Номер два должен открыть окно с веб-формой. Хотя веб-браузер загружен правильно, всякий раз, когда я нажимаю кнопку № 2, программа зависает, и пользовательская форма не отображается.

Есть идеи, что я могу попробовать?

Заранее спасибо,

Alex

PS: не много занимался кодированием, просто

Public Class Form1 

  Private Sub btnClickThis_Click(sender As Object, e As EventArgs) Handles btnClickThis.Click 
    Form2.Show() 
  End Sub 

  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click 
      Form3.Show() 
  End Sub 

End Class

на первой пользовательской форме, чтобы загрузить пользовательскую форму 3, которая содержит веб-представление. У пользовательской формы 3 это просто есть.

Public Class Form3

  Private Sub Form3_Shown(sender As Object, e As EventArgs) Handles Me.Shown
      WebViewCompatible1.Navigate("https://google.de/")
  End Sub

End Class
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...